`DuplicateVoteEvidence` represents a validator that has voted for two different blocks
|
||||
in the same round of the same height. Votes are lexicographically sorted on `BlockID`.
|
||||
|
||||
| Name | Type | Description | Validation |
|
||||
|-------|---------------|-----------------------------------------------------------------|-----------------------------------------------------|
|
||||
| VoteA | [Vote](#vote) | One of the votes submitted by a validator when they equivocated | VoteA must adhere to [Vote](#vote) validation rules |
|
||||
| VoteB | [Vote](#vote) | The second vote submitted by a validator when they equivocated | VoteB must adhere to [Vote](#vote) validation rules |
|
||||
| Name | Type | Description | Validation |
|
||||
|------------------|---------------|--------------------------------------------------------------------|-----------------------------------------------------|
|
||||
| VoteA | [Vote](#vote) | One of the votes submitted by a validator when they equivocated | VoteA must adhere to [Vote](#vote) validation rules |
|
||||
| VoteB | [Vote](#vote) | The second vote submitted by a validator when they equivocated | VoteB must adhere to [Vote](#vote) validation rules |
|
||||
| TotalVotingPower | int64 | The total power of the validator set at the height of equivocation | Must be equal to nodes own copy of the data |
|
||||
| ValidatorPower | int64 | Power of the equivocating validator at the height | Must be equal to the nodes own copy of the data |
|
||||
| Timestamp | [Time](#Time) | Time of the block where the equivocation occurred | Must be equal to the nodes own copy of the data |
|
||||
|
||||
Valid Duplicate Vote Evidence must adhere to the following rules:
|
||||
|
||||
@@ -311,6 +314,8 @@ Valid Duplicate Vote Evidence must adhere to the following rules:
|
||||
|
||||
- For DuplicateVoteEvidence to be included in a block it must be within the time period outlined in [evidenceParams](../abci/abci.md#evidenceparams). Evidence expiration is measured as a combination of age in terms of height and time.
|
||||
|
||||
- Information required to form ABCI evidence (`TotalVotingPower`, `ValidatorPower` and `Timestamp`) must all match the nodes own state at that height.
|

### LightClientAttackEvidence
|
||||
|
||||
LightClientAttackEvidence is a generalized evidence that captures all forms of known attacks on
|
||||
@@ -318,10 +323,13 @@ a light client such that a full node can verify, propose and commit the evidence
|
||||
punishment of the malicious validators. There are three forms of attacks: Lunatic, Equivocation
|
||||
and Amnesia. These attacks are exhaustive. You can find a more detailed overview of this [here](../light-client/accountability#the_misbehavior_of_faulty_validators)

## LightBlock
|
||||
|
||||
LightBlock is the core data structure of the [light client](../light-client/README.md). It combines two data structures needed for verification ([signedHeader](#signedheader) & [validatorSet](#validatorset)).
